WebAug 21, 2009 · Divide the difference in height by the length of the treadmill belt. If your treadmill is 45 inches long and you determine the incline is 3 inches higher than it was at a 0 percent incline, you have an incline grade of 3/45 or 6.7 percent. Repeat for your other incline settings. You may want to write down all the incline grades so you do not ...
